Virtual Private Cloud (VPC) Market to Reach $60 Billion by 2034, Growing at 9% CAGR
Virtual Private Cloud (VPC) Market Report (2025–2034) Luton, Bedfordshire, United Kingdom, June 03,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Executive Summary The global Virtual Private Cloud (VPC) market is projected to grow from $25 billion in 2024 to approximately $60 billion by 2034, registering a CAGR of 9% over the forecast period. This growth is primarily driven by the increasing demand for secure, scalable, and customizable cloud solutions across industries. Enterprise demand for advanced cloud infrastructure is rising as businesses strive to optimize costs, enhance data security, and maintain regulatory compliance. The integration of AI, machine learning, and hybrid cloud architectures is accelerating VPC adoption, particularly in sectors like IT, BFSI, and healthcare. Growing Need for Secure and Scalable Cloud Infrastructure Security as a Priority: As data breaches and ransomware attacks escalate, enterprises demand isolated, secure, and encrypted environments—which VPCs provide through features like network segmentation, firewall rules, and access control. Scalability Benefits: VPCs allow organizations to scale applications and workloads dynamically, without compromising data security or performance. 2. Increasing Compliance with Data Privacy Regulations Regulatory Pressure: Global regulations such as GDPR (Europe), CCPA (California), PDPA (Singapore), and HIPAA (US Healthcare) are compelling enterprises to shift from public to compliance-ready private cloud environments. VPC Advantage: VPCs help enterprises achieve data residency, auditability, and fine-grained policy control, reducing legal risks. 3. Rising Adoption of Hybrid and Multi-Cloud Strategies Enterprises are avoiding vendor lock-in by spreading workloads across different cloud environments. VPCs offer seamless connectivity between public and private clouds, facilitating consistent performance and governance. Hybrid setups also allow latency-sensitive workloads to stay on-premise while leveraging the cloud for elasticity and scale. 4. Integration of AI/ML for Intelligent Data Management Cloud service providers are embedding AI/ML models into VPC environments for: Predictive threat detection Real-time anomaly monitoring Automated resource scaling and performance optimization AI-powered VPCs can automatically flag risks, recommend configurations, and even self-heal networks. 5. Expansion of Remote Work and Collaboration Needs The post-pandemic rise in remote and hybrid workforces has driven the need for secure, anytime-anywhere access to data and applications. VPCs offer VPN-integrated, access-controlled environments suitable for distributed teams and collaboration across geographies. Market Restraints 1. Cloud Security Misconceptions Affecting Adoption Some organizations, especially SMEs and public institutions, still believe public or virtualized cloud environments are inherently unsafe. Lack of awareness of VPC benefits (like isolation, encryption, and auditability) slows market penetration. 2. Vendor Lock-In Concerns Deterring Cloud Transitions Customers are wary of getting tied into proprietary APIs, tools, and pricing models from single cloud vendors. Interoperability limitations and data migration challenges often delay decisions to fully commit to VPC platforms. 3. Supply Chain Volatility Impacting Service Continuity Global chip shortages, geopolitical tensions, and rising energy costs have led to delays in data center expansions and cloud infrastructure upgrades, especially in emerging markets. These disruptions affect VPC service provisioning and long-term cost planning. 4. Price Competition Reducing Provider Margins Intense competition among hyperscalers like AWS, Microsoft Azure, and Google Cloud is compressing margins, especially in emerging regions. HPE Announces Cloud Security and Network Management Updates
Home » Emerging technologies » Networking » HPE Announces New Cloud Security and Network Management Updates Hewlett Packard Enterprise (HPE) has announced significant advancements in its cloud security and network management offerings. The company revealed expanded deployment options and enhanced security features to meet the evolving needs of enterprises and government entities. Jacob Chacko, Regional Director for the Middle East & Africa at HPE Aruba Networking, reported that organizations increasingly prioritize data sovereignty. He explained that HPE addresses this with flexible network management deployment. Moreover, innovations in AI, security, and connectivity are integrated into HPE Aruba Networking Central. This powerful solution helps organizations meet security, privacy, and control requirements. HPE Aruba Networking Central now offers four deployment options: cloud-delivered SaaS, Virtual Private Cloud (VPC), on-premises, and Network-as-a-Service (NaaS). These expansions provide the widest set of advanced network management capabilities available in the industry. Consequently, organizations can choose the deployment model best aligned with their data sovereignty, security, and compliance needs. The VPC option allows customers to operate within a dedicated, secure cloud environment. This ensures data control and regulatory compliance. Additionally, the on-premises option supports air-gapped environments. This meets government-level security requirements while enabling efficient AI data capture, training, and inferencing. Furthermore, HPE Aruba Networking and HPE GreenLake cloud are expanding to help enterprises modernize secure connectivity and hybrid cloud operations. They blend multi-layered and zero trust approaches to protect against threats. New features include cloud-based access control security in Aruba Networking Central and threat-adaptive security through HPE Private Cloud Enterprise. These updates are compliant with the Digital Operations Resilience Act (DORA). HPE also reported new cybersecurity services designed for sovereign clouds and AI. The latest updates to Aruba Networking Central introduce an always-on, AI-powered network automation capability. This continuously monitors wired and wireless network operations to optimize performance. AI assistants act as network architects, diagnosing issues and recommending solutions. They help close security gaps, extend capacity, and prevent configuration errors. Key points: Four deployment models: SaaS, VPC, on-premises, NaaS Enhanced zero trust and multi-layered cloud security AI-powered automation for continuous network monitoring These advancements highlight HPE's commitment to providing flexible, secure cloud solutions for modern enterprises and government organizations.

SIOS Technology Announces Strategic Partnership with DataHub Nepal to Deliver High-Availability and Disaster Recovery Solutions in Nepal
SAN MATEO, Calif., April 23,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- SIOS Technology Corp., a leading provider of application high availability (HA) and disaster recovery (DR) solutions, today announced a strategic partnership with DataHub Nepal, a trusted leader in co-location, hosting, premium data centers, cloud, and managed services in Nepal. The collaboration aims to strengthen the availability and resilience of mission-critical applications for businesses across the region. 'Our strategic partnership with SIOS Technology has significantly enhanced our ability to deliver proven, robust, and cost-effective HA and DR solutions,' said Deepak Shrestha, Managing Director, DataHub Nepal. 'Businesses throughout Nepal can now operate with greater resilience, confident that their critical data and operations are protected by our cutting-edge HA/DR services.' With over a decade of expertise, DataHub Nepal stands as a leading provider of secure, scalable, and reliable infrastructure designed to ensure seamless business continuity. Leveraging state-of-the-art infrastructure, DataHub empowers businesses to maintain uninterrupted operations despite unforeseen disasters. Its comprehensive range of services includes IaaS (Infrastructure-as-a-Service), PaaS (Platform-as-a-Service), Virtual Private Cloud (VPC), Private Cloud, Backup and Disaster Recovery as a Service (DRaaS), and Web Application Firewall (WAF). Strengthening its business continuity and disaster recovery offerings, DataHub Nepal has partnered with SIOS Technology to deliver HA and DR solutions across various industries, including banking, financial institutions, ICT companies, fintech, and enterprises/SMEs within Nepal. DataHub utilizes the SIOS Protection Suite for Windows/Linux environments, implementing SIOS clustering to achieve high-availability service level agreements (SLAs) established by Customer Business Continuity Plans within optimal cost parameters. The SIOS solution seamlessly aligns with its business continuity requirements, offering established reliability, minimal downtime, and protection against false failovers. They found that with the SIOS HA solution, they were able to help customers save more than 70% of the costs without having to invest in expensive SAN hardware, or enterprise editions of SQL, Oracle Databases, SAP and other applications, which is one of the many deciding factors for many of their customers, on top of a highly reliable software and dependable support team that differentiates SIOS from other vendors in similar space. 'We are excited to partner with DataHub Nepal to deliver high availability and disaster recovery solutions that meet the critical needs of businesses throughout the region,' said Masahiro Arai, Chief Operating Officer, SIOS Technology. 'This collaboration underscores our commitment to providing dependable, cost-effective solutions that enable customers to achieve their business continuity goals with confidence.' About SIOS Technology Corp. SIOS Technology Corp. high availability and disaster recovery solutions ensure availability and eliminate data loss for critical Windows and Linux applications operating across physical, virtual, cloud, and hybrid cloud environments. SIOS clustering software is essential for any IT infrastructure with applications requiring a high degree of resiliency, ensuring uptime without sacrificing performance or data, protecting businesses from local failures and regional outages, planned and unplanned. Forlex Showcases Game-Changing Sovereignty AI at Web Summit Qatar 2025, Secures Investor Interest and Government PoC Discussions
DOHA, QATAR / / March 1, 2025 / Forlex, an emerging leader in autonomous legal AI, made a powerful impression at Web Summit Qatar 2025, positioning itself as one of the event's most talked-about companies. The Brazilian-based startup, known for its pioneering approach to sovereign AI infrastructure and automated legal workflows, engaged in numerous high-profile conversations about proof of concepts (PoCs) with Qatari enterprises and government agencies. This milestone event also attracted significant investor interest, signaling a potential new funding round on the horizon. At the core of Forlex's allure is its exclusive AI technology, purpose-built to ensure data sovereignty-a critical factor for companies and governments that need to maintain strict control over confidential information. Unlike many competing solutions reliant on third-party, often overseas, AI platforms, Forlex's specialized models can be deployed within private cloud infrastructures, giving customers unrivaled security and privacy. "We have been building from the ground up an international specialized model which ensures that data is secure and private," said CTO and Co-Founder, Daniel Augustus. "That resonates strongly with organizations and government agencies seeking greater operational autonomy and protection for their sensitive data." Standing Out at Web Summit Qatar 2025 Highlighted Company: Forlex was among the select startups recognized for innovation in the legal technology and AI domain, drawing attention from decision-makers across multiple industries. Government PoCs: Early discussions with key government entities in Qatar showcased the potential impact of Forlex's technology in enhancing compliance, automating legal workflows, and bolstering national data sovereignty. Investor Momentum: A robust lineup of investors expressed interest in joining Forlex's next funding round. Conversations are already underway, underscoring strong market confidence in the company's vision. A New Standard in Legal AI Forlex's autonomous legal AI platform, LIVIA, sets a new standard by orchestrating a suite of 13 specialized AI models-one fully proprietary to Forlex and 12 customized derivatives. This holistic approach enables 70% of routine legal tasks to be automated, freeing professionals to focus on high-value strategic work. Thanks to the platform's flexible deployment options, clients can choose a fully sovereign solution, managing and securing all sensitive data in-house or within a Virtual Private Cloud (VPC).
